Earliest and latest sunrise and sunset in Bergshamra, Stockholm
In Bergshamra, Stockholm, the earliest sunrise of 2026 is on June 18 at 3:26 am, while the latest sunrise is on December 27 at 8:42 am. The earliest sunset is on December 16 at 2:49 pm, and the latest sunset is on June 23 at 10:12 pm.
Bergshamra, Stockholm gets 12h 35m more daylight on the longest day than on the shortest one (18h 45m versus 6h 10m). Averaged over the whole year, a day lasts 12h 27m.
Bergshamra Analemma
Due to Earth's tilted axis and slightly elliptical orbit, the Sun is never seen in the same position at noon in Bergshamra. Throughout the year, it slowly traces this figure-eight:
Move along the curve to read the Sun's altitude and azimuth for any day of the year in Bergshamra.
Over the year, the 12:00 Sun swings between just 7.1° above the horizon (around Dec 20) and 54° (around Jun 20) in Bergshamra. The smaller loop sits at the top, the signature of a Northern Hemisphere analemma.

Why does the figure look wider here than in the sky view above?
Both draw the same data, but with different conventions. The sky view uses the same scale on both axes, so it shows the analemma with its true proportions, as a camera would capture it: about 47° tall and only a few degrees wide. This chart, like most technical analemma diagrams, stretches each axis independently to fill the plot, expanding the narrow azimuth range several times so its day-to-day variation can actually be read. Also, azimuth is not sky distance: near the zenith, one degree of azimuth spans much less than one degree across the sky, which further widens the figure in this representation.
